Bulb for automobile lamp
The present invention relates to a bulb for a motor vehicle lamp, comprising a body having a housing providing at least one compartment for housing an electronic card on which is mounted at least one light emitting diode, and a tip, connected to said housing, said tip being arranged to define a base adapted to cooperate with a socket for a bulb type "TIO glass base (wedge base)", said bulb also comprising means for electrical connection of said light emitting diode with the electrical circuit of said lamp.
Due to the low power consumption of light-emitting diodes (LEDs), their long lifetime and their advantageous properties in terms of electrical safety, it is now recommended to use, instead of temporary bulbs, for example of the filament or halogen type, including in the field of motor vehicle lamps, "LED bulbs". Conventionally, the latter have a structure in which at least one electronic card, on which is welded at least one light-emitting diode, is encapsulated inside a container for example plastic, or glass, extended by a part end or a cap forming tip able to cooperate with a socket. Thus, there are currently on the market many models of LED bulbs differing from each other not only by the shape of the container, the t3φe material used to manufacture it, or its color, but also by the shape of the intended end part compatible with the different formats of existing traditional lampholders or lamp holders.
Thus, in the field of bulbs for motor vehicle lamps, such as in particular a pilot light, a ceiling lamp, a door lamp, etc., more particularly targeted by the present invention, there are also to date many products to LED base that can be substituted for traditional bulbs. These products are generally composed of several pieces of plastic material supporting one or more printed circuits, while the electrical connection of Wdes LED is made by means of metal pins welded to the printed circuit boards and folded around a terminal part x defining a base .
The object of the present invention is to propose a new LED bulb suitable for being substituted for a conventional "T10 baseball" type bulb, which is of simpler structure than the similar products offered for sale at present, so that to reduce the production costs, which is particularly robust, and which also makes it possible to make an electrical connection "lamp clamp" with greater flexibility. The present invention relates to an LED bulb 1 for a motor vehicle lamp, such as for example a ceiling lamp or a night light, etc., conventionally having a type of lamp type "TIO glass base (wedge base)". With reference to the figures, and according to the invention, such an ampoule 1 comprises a body 2, preferably made in one piece of a suitable plastic material, at least partially transparent, tinted, or diffusing, depending on the type of desired lighting. The body 2 has a housing 3 divided into a first and a second superimposed compartments 3a, 3b. These are respectively able to accommodate an electronic card 4a on which is mounted a light emitting diode (LED) 5 (upper compartment 3a), and an electronic card 4b for driving the LED 5 (lower compartment 3b). The body 2 of the bulb 1 further comprises a tip 6, located in the extension of the lower compartment 3b, and configured to define a base adapted to cooperate with a socket for type of bulb "TIO glass base (wedge base)". Furthermore, the bulb 1 comprises a pair of identical metal members 7 for ensuring the electrical connection of said LED 5, and adapted to be fitted on the body 2 and the electronic cards 4a, 4b, as will be described more in details below.
In fact, according to the invention, the housing 3 of the body 2 comprises a bottom 30 whose underside 31 is extended by the end piece 6 and the upper face is bordered by two opposite side walls 33. The latter extend into a plane perpendicular to the plane of insertion of the end piece 6 in a socket for a type of bulb "TIO glass base (wedge base)", and are overcome, in the embodiment shown, by an upper wall 34 of curved shape having a central opening 35 adapted to accommodate, if necessary, a means of distribution to different directions of the light radiation emitted by the LED 5. The housing further comprises an intermediate wall 36 parallel to the bottom 30, extending between the latter and the upper wall 35. Thus, the upper compartment 3a is delimited by the upper wall 35, the intermediate wall 36 and the two side walls 33, while the lower compartment 3b is delimited by the intermediate wall 36, the two side walls 33 and the bottom 30. Furthermore, each compartment 3a, 3b has a pair of grooves 37a, 37b formed vis-à-vis one another if the inner face of each side wall 33 to accommodate and support the opposite edges of the respective electronic cards 4a, 4b.
As illustrated in the figures, the tip 6 has a substantially Y-shaped section whose rectilinear branch comprises two opposite faces 60a, 60b symmetrical with respect to the longitudinal axis of the tip 6. In fact, each face 60a, 60b comprises a central band 61 in relief with respect to two end zones 62, 63 bordering it. The end zone 62 has a flat surface, while the end zone 63 has a notch 64 of axis parallel to the bottom 30 of the housing 3 adapted to cooperate with electrical connection elements which is provided in a conventional manner a socket of type "TIO glass base (wedge base)" when the bulb 1 and said socket are nested.
Furthermore, according to the invention, each metal member 7 is formed from a metal plate cut and folded so as to have an upper portion provided with holding arms in position 70 and connecting arms 71, 72 intended to be engaged respectively through complementary orifices 8, 9, 10, which each side wall 33 of the housing 3 comprises and which are preferentially distributed in an area where each side wall has a recess 11 on its outer face. Each metal member 7 further has a lower portion, having a connecting blade 73 whose structure is arranged to fit at least a part of the tip 6 and more specifically, to rest against the end area 62 with a flat surface of one of its faces 60a, 60b. In addition, the structure of each metal member 7 is provided such that the connecting arms 71, 72 and the holding arms in position 70 are extended by a rear face, perpendicular to the plane in which they extend, connecting them to the connecting blade 73, and adapted to be housed in the recess 11 when the metal member 7 and the body 2 are coupled. Each metal member 7 also has a positioning tab 75 adapted to be accommodated and guided in translation in a groove 12 of corresponding shape opening on a longitudinal slot 13 formed in one of said side walls 33 of the housing 3.
As is clear from the foregoing, the bulb 1 according to the invention has a structure that is both very simple, compact and robust, without prominent elements, which is based on a simple interlocking of a few independent parts monobloc devoid of zones fragility that can have a negative impact on their life. More particularly, the assembly of the various constituent parts of the bulb 1 according to the invention is very quick to realize since it simply consists in inserting the edges of the electronic card (s) 4a, 4b into the corresponding grooves 37a, 37b, by providing for positioning the electronic card 4a carrying the LED 5 in the upper compartment 3a, so that the LED 5 is located vis-à-vis the upper wall 34 of the housing 3, then to fit the two metal members 7 on the body 2.
As mentioned above, this last step consists, for each connecting member 7, to introduce the holding arms in position 70 and the connecting arms 71, 72 in the orifices 8, 9, 10 while the positioning tab 75 is slid into the corresponding groove 12, before pushing the assembly towards the compartments 3a, 3b until the rear face 74 of the metal member 7 rests in a recess 11 of a side wall 33 of the housing 3. The correct positioning of a metal member 7 is facilitated by the cooperation between the positioning tab 75 and the groove 12. Once in position, each metal member 7 remains clipped on the body 2 by means of its retaining tabs. position 70, while the electrical connection between the electrical circuit of the lamp receiving the bulb 1 and the electronic cards 4a, 4b is achieved through the connection arms 71, 72 which define tagously connecting areas by elastic contact with one or other of the electronic cards 4a, 4b, requiring no weld point may break over time.
Moreover, each metal member 7 is designed so as to also allow the electrical connection between the two electronic cards 4a, 4b, in the case of an electronic control of the LED 5, as in the illustrated embodiment, without requiring additional specific connection means. Zones 14 for separating by electric bridge breaks (dishing) are also provided to perform the various control modes that can be envisaged (resistive with the electronic card 4a carrying the LED 5 alone, or electronic when the electronic card 4a carrying the LED 5 is coupled to an electronic card 4b carrying an electronic control of the T .ED 5).
Thus, the goals set by the present invention are achieved and the bulb 1 which has just been described is both simplified manufacturing and therefore low cost, easy to use and improved life, while offering the possibility of providing different types of lighting in accordance with the range conventionally proposed on the market in the same field.
